Miron Muslic to Leave Plymouth Argyle

  • Miron Muslic, Plymouth Argyle's head coach since January 2025, is set to leave the club to join German side Schalke in the coming season.
  • Muslic's departure follows regular end-of-season communication and stems from his desire to be closer to his family after four years away from them.
  • Muslic succeeded Wayne Rooney as head coach, was unable to prevent Plymouth's relegation from the Championship, but achieved a memorable upset against Liverpool in the FA Cup during his time in charge.
  • Plymouth Argyle reluctantly allowed Muslic to begin talks with Schalke, agreeing to a £1 million compensation fee, while expressing frustration and wishing him well.
  • His exit after four months of a three-and-a-half-year contract leaves Plymouth aiming for a swift return to the Championship amid ongoing squad rebuilding.
